1841 Antique Steel engraving of St Canice’s Cathedral in Kilkenny. The print was engraved by James Carter and is after a drawing by William Bartlett. St Canice’s Cathedral is also known as Kilkenny Cathedral.

The engraving is 5 by 7 inches and is mounted in Antique White and will fit into a standard A4 frame ( which measures 21.0 x 29.7cm or 8.27 x 11.69 inches)

The engraving is in good overall condition for age with only a couple of small areas of foxing, please see pictures.
